On 03/03/2012 10:30 AM, Sreekumar TP wrote:
Could someone throw some light on this issue too?

I can't see from the stack trace why this is crashing.

Does it crash if you run the query from the sqlite shell?

Maybe try building the shell without optimizations, and
then running it under valgrind.
